腾讯 软件开发-后台开发方向

背景:双非 计算机专业

一面 视频会议 0805 1h

  • hashmap和treemap底层结构 复杂度 是否是线程安全的
  • currentHashMap是线程安全吗 如何实现线程安全
  • 内存溢出和内存泄漏
  • 递归会造成栈溢出,循环为什么不会
  • CAS怎么解决ABA问题
  • mysql中InnoDB索引底层结构
  • 为什么用建议用自增ID作索引而不用UUID
  • A向B发送3个100MB的数据 怎么确保B准确收到
  • TCP流量控制
  • Socket编程
  • 介绍一下参加比赛的项目 实现了什么功能 个人职责
  • 使用过的技术
  • 平时有没有使用到多线程
  • 进程和线程共享的区域
  • 如何实现进程通信
  • 进程从内存中读取100MB要读几次
  • 操作系统内存态和用户态
  • 反问
  • 两个编程题:快排+查找链表的中间节点

    回去补充一下操作系统的知识

二面 视频会议 0810 1h25min

项目

  • 介绍项目
  • 存储内容到mysql的中文乱码问题
  • 登录设计
  • 有无考虑并发问题
  • 遇到的问题 怎么解决
  • UI设计要注意什么
  • 数据流图要注意什么
  • 用例图
  • 数据库使用第几范式
  • 第三范式和反范式相比的优缺点

算法

  • 反转链表
  • 给定一个非负整数数组,你最初位于数组的第一个位置。 数组中的每个元素代表你在该位置可以跳跃的最大长度。判断能否跳跃到最后的位置。例如:[3,2,1,0,4],从第一个位置开始跳3步、2步、1步都无法到达最后的位置,返回false。

基础

  • Linux查看系统负载的命令
  • TCP四次挥手
  • TCP怎么保证有序到达
  • 若重复发送同样的报文 接收端怎么区分
  • TCP和UDP区别
  • 操作系统进程通信方式
  • 进程和线程
  • 进程组
  • Mysql索引数据结构
  • Mysql varchar字段怎么存储(与text)

    计网、操作系统、进程可以补充一下

三面 电话 0813 30min

突然打电话来 问我方不方便
: 非常方便

闲聊

  • 目前在哪里?籍贯是哪里的?
  • 深圳有没有熟人

正式

  • 计算机专业的系统课程都了解吗
  • 平衡二叉树和红黑树的区别
  • java的hashmap
  • 数据库索引一般用什么结构 为什么不用红黑树
  • 聚集索引和非聚集索引
  • 操作系统进程间通信性能最高的方式是哪种 为什么
  • 进程间遇到同时读取一个数据 会遇到什么问题 怎么解决
  • 线程和协程的区别
  • 做过什么项目
  • 该项目是自己完成的吗?基于什么目的完成的
  • 为什么没有考虑留在实习公司

问项目

  • 印象比较深刻是哪个项目 介绍一下
  • 项目印象深刻的地方(我说了文章的样式的存储长度问题 面试官提示说markdown不具备颜色等样式 可以用word存储在服务器的磁盘上)
  • 完成了多少行代码?代码存在哪里?(一般存在码云 面试官可能想看)
  • 程序怎么调试 如果前端数据有问题
  • 项目有哪些表?介绍其中一张表
  • 评论表有建立索引吗(没有...)如果要建立索引要建立什么索引 联合索引

反问

  • 有没有回答错误的地方

可以的话一般一周左右会联系

hr面 电话 0816 20min

  • hr介绍岗位(目前主要是golang为主,java为辅)
  • 能否学习go语言
  • 籍贯
  • 询问工作地点
  • 项目 难点 怎么解决
  • 你是一个什么样的人?
  • 是否有亲人在腾讯
  • 为什么不选择考研
  • 学校毕设时间
  • 后期是否有时间先来实习 没时间也没事的
  • 有什么问题要问的

电话一挂,就收到云证和性格测评了。

全程的每一个面试官人都很好,虽然视频会议面试官没有开视频,但是你不会的都会告诉你,都非常有耐心,非常nice~~!!!

#腾讯22届秋招面试##面经##校招##基础架构工程师##腾讯#
全部评论
楼主,A向B发送3个100MB的数据 怎么确保B准确收到,这个问题肿么回答
2 回复 分享
发布于 2021-08-16 22:22
感觉问的都挺还好,既能考察基础又能考察一定的能力。感觉很多面试官问的,为了难而难
2 回复 分享
发布于 2021-08-16 22:22
楼主面的是日常实习吗?什么时候去实习呢
1 回复 分享
发布于 2021-09-30 09:03
羡慕,我腾讯到三面完之后挂了。
4 回复 分享
发布于 2021-08-17 11:39
腾讯喜欢双非本科?
1 回复 分享
发布于 2021-08-17 11:22
楼主好棒,一路走来,孤单否?
1 回复 分享
发布于 2021-08-17 07:58
明天teg面试,怎么办?
点赞 回复 分享
发布于 2021-08-22 11:16
大佬一面的手撕快排就是很单纯的写个快排嘛?还是有其他变化?
点赞 回复 分享
发布于 2021-08-22 01:53
我也是TEG,为什么二面就HR了..
点赞 回复 分享
发布于 2021-08-19 22:49
varchar是怎么存储的?
点赞 回复 分享
发布于 2021-08-18 13:53
楼主应该有非常硬核发竞赛证书和实习经历,👍
点赞 回复 分享
发布于 2021-08-17 18:50
好难😭
点赞 回复 分享
发布于 2021-08-17 17:29
三面的话是电话面吗?
点赞 回复 分享
发布于 2021-08-17 16:49
感谢楼主分享~借楼:度小满(原百度金融)内推,欢迎大家投递,岗位多多~ https://app.mokahr.com/recommendation-apply/duxiaoman/1484?recommendCode=NTADX6B&codeType=1#/jobs?isCampusJob=1&zhineng=&page=1  可以加952283469 这个qq群询问内推进度或其他问题咨询 群里有很多校招的小伙伴们 愿offer多多,感谢支持!
点赞 回复 分享
发布于 2021-08-17 14:30
恭喜大佬😁
点赞 回复 分享
发布于 2021-08-17 14:03
请问楼主什么时候投递的,我投递了意向部门teg基础架构,还没有消息
点赞 回复 分享
发布于 2021-08-17 11:17
是否学习Go,是不是进去都得转的呀
点赞 回复 分享
发布于 2021-08-17 11:16
请问每面隔多久?
点赞 回复 分享
发布于 2021-08-17 11:06
请问楼下主方便把简历发一份吗,想参考一下
点赞 回复 分享
发布于 2021-08-17 10:59
问了hr什么时候发意向书了吗
点赞 回复 分享
发布于 2021-08-17 10:12

相关推荐

点赞 评论 收藏
分享
03-20 15:35
深圳大学 golang
人生第一次面腾讯 部门是CSIG的技术与产品 3.16晚上面的 大概1h 问的问题挺多的 手撕给了两道10分钟就写完了 反问环节面试官评价也挺正向 还说两道手撕都很快写出来了挺不错的(他说他一般给两道是会让候选人自己选一道的) 感觉自己发挥挺正常的 以为应该可以过 结果八点面完九点就给挂了 不知道是不是kpi面 人生中第一场鹅面试就这么狠狠被挂掉了1. 自我介绍 顺便介绍两个项目2. 你说到你的项目是微服务架构 那你说说微服务是什么?3. 你的评价系统用到了Canal 你为什么要用Canal?4. 面试官说他记得Canal的配置是比较复杂的 他说有很多复杂的配置文件 问我当时是怎么去配置的 有没有遇到什么难题?5. 你的后台消费脚本怎么判断一条语句是DDL语句还是DML语句的?(刚好有考虑到这一点就回答了根据Kafka里面的消息来判断)6. 那怎么判断是不是DCL语句呢?(这个确实没考虑到)7. 你的项目用到了SSE 说一下SSE和http有什么区别 SSE是单向的吗?8. 你的RAG项目是为什么架构的?为什么要使用Eino框架 它在里面起到了什么作用?9. 你的文档存到向量数据库的索引是怎么设计的?10. 召回文档的时候是怎么召回的?召回的是文档的ID还是文档的内容?11. 说一下OSI七层网络模型和TCP-IP的四层网络模型 每一层分别有哪些东西介绍一下(只记得四层 七层的没说全 太久没看了忘了)12. 说一下TCP的三次握手和四次挥手13. Go里面的error和panic有什么区别?14. 那panic是怎么捕获的 说一下15. 那Defer是用来干什么的?16. Go里面的Context有了解过吗 介绍一下Context可以用来做什么?17. 说一下Go语言里面的零值18. 为什么两个项目一个用Gin框架一个用Kratos框架?19. 为什么手撕代码一道题用C++、一道题用Go? (说之前打编程比赛的时候习惯用C++写算法题 链表和二叉树的题目就习惯用C++写)手撕代码出了两道都是简单难度的leetcode 但是第二道不能额外开辟新数组 用逆向双指针就可以解决了:1. 判断链表是否有环 (自己写输入输出构建链表)2. 合并两个有序数组(要求不可以额外开一个新数组 只能使用常量级别的额外空间)
查看19道真题和解析
点赞 评论 收藏
分享
评论
47
259
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务